Transaction 877283d28eecae2f2af47ed172a6fc87b60b1fc24fdb2666ada377f42f75e8a7
1 Input
1 Output
-
877283d28eecae2f2af47ed172a6fc87b60b1fc24fdb2666ada377f42f75e8a7:0
- value
- 1749681
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4c56996d9ed545cba6cdb25763bd5d55afc8112 OP_EQUAL
- address
- 3Q1FHoqocAQDRoETBNVWmRswQLNVm9312h